Hexagonal V Belt Construction and Design Features

Hexagonal V belts, also known as double V belts or hex belts, are power transmission belts with a hexagonal cross-section that enables power transmission from both the top and bottom surfaces. This dual-sided capability makes them suitable for serpentine drive layouts where pulleys contact both sides of the belt and some driven shafts require rotation reversal.

Double-Sided V Profile Design

The belt features two V profiles joined at the back, creating a hexagonal shape with four angled sidewalls. The top and bottom surfaces are recessed to maintain sidewall contact with pulley grooves while preserving flexibility. Each side functions independently as a V belt, allowing the belt to drive pulleys on either side of the belt path without flipping or re-routing.

Material Composition and Reinforcement

The belt body is constructed from a rubber compound, typically polychloroprene or EPDM, formulated for flex resistance and environmental stability. A tensile cord of polyester or aramid fiber runs along the neutral plane to carry tension loads. The sidewall surfaces are fabric-covered for abrasion resistance and consistent friction characteristics against pulley groove walls.

Hex Belt Specifications and Dimensional Data

Standard Sizes (AA / BB / CC)

Section

Top Width (mm)

Height per Side (mm)

Total Height (mm)

Angle (degrees)

AA

13.0

8.0

16.0

40

BB

17.0

11.0

22.0

40

CC

22.0

14.0

28.0

40

Performance Parameters and Tolerances

Operating temperature range is -45°C to +80°C for standard rubber compounds. Length tolerance conforms to ISO 5289 specifications. The belt's symmetric design means both sides carry equal load ratings, and the belt can be installed in either orientation without affecting performance. Flex life is rated for continuous operation with proper tensioning and sheave alignment.

Industrial Applications for Double V Belts

Serpentine and Multi-Shaft Drive Systems

Hexagonal belts are specified for serpentine drive arrangements where the belt must contact pulleys on both sides, such as systems with backside idlers or reverse-rotation driven shafts. The dual V profile eliminates the need for multiple belts or complex routing in applications requiring power transfer to shafts rotating in opposite directions.

Textile Machinery and Agricultural Equipment

AA and BB sections are commonly used in textile machinery including spinning frames, looms, and yarn processing equipment where multi-shaft transmission and reverse rotation are required. BB and CC sections serve agricultural machinery such as combine harvesters, balers, and seed drills, where drive layouts demand power transfer from both belt sides across multiple shafts.

International Standards and Quality Control

ISO 5289, DIN 772 and RMA Compliance

Production adheres to ISO 5289 for double V belt dimensions and tolerances, DIN 772 for German industrial standards, and RMA (Rubber Manufacturers Association) specifications for North American markets. Belt length markings follow the standard numbering system corresponding to inside length measurements.

Production Testing and Validation

Each batch undergoes dimensional inspection including top width, total height, and angle verification. Tensile strength testing confirms cord integrity, and length matching ensures belts supplied as sets fall within matched tolerance bands. Lot identification codes provide traceability to material batches, production date, and quality inspection records.

FAQ About Hexagonal V Belts

What is a hexagonal V belt used for?

Hexagonal V belts are used in drive systems that require power transmission from both sides of the belt, such as serpentine drives with backside pulleys, multi-shaft arrangements with reverse rotation, and applications where a single belt must drive multiple shafts rotating in different directions. They are common in textile machinery and agricultural equipment.

How do AA, BB, and CC hexagonal belts differ?

AA, BB, and CC refer to the cross-section sizes, corresponding to classical A, B, and C V belt dimensions doubled to form a hexagonal profile. AA is the smallest section with a 13 mm top width and 16 mm total height; BB measures 17 mm by 22 mm; and CC is the largest at 22 mm by 28 mm. Selection depends on power requirements and pulley dimensions.

Can hexagonal belts transmit power from both sides?

Yes, hexagonal belts are designed to transmit power from both the top and bottom V profiles. The symmetric hexagonal cross-section allows pulleys to engage with either side of the belt, making them suitable for serpentine drives, reverse-rotation applications, and multi-shaft systems where the belt wraps around pulleys on opposite sides.

What standards do hexagonal V belts conform to?

Hexagonal V belts conform to ISO 5289 (international standard for double V belts), DIN 772 (German standard), and RMA (Rubber Manufacturers Association) specifications. These standards define dimensional tolerances, length classification, and test methods for belt performance verification.
